brain-multiple-modalities-automl


Namebrain-multiple-modalities-automl JSON
Version 0.0.1 PyPI version JSON
download
home_pagehttps://github.com/chandraveshchaudhari/browser-automationpy
SummaryA Python project
upload_time2024-05-29 13:24:58
maintainerNone
docs_urlNone
authorA. Random Developer
requires_python<4,>=3.6
licenseNone
keywords browser automation selenium testing data mining
VCS
bugtrack_url
requirements No requirements were recorded.
Travis-CI No Travis.
coveralls test coverage No coveralls.
            # Brain-AutoML
<div align="center">
  <img src="https://raw.githubusercontent.com/chandraveshchaudhari/personal-information/initial_setup/logos/my%20github%20logo%20template-systematic-reviewpy%20small.png" width="640" height="320">
</div>

# An open-source Python framework for systematic review based on PRISMA : systematic-reviewpy
> Chaudhari, C., Purswani, G. (2023). Stock Market Prediction Techniques Using Artificial Intelligence: A Systematic Review. In: Kumar, S., Sharma, H., Balachandran, K., Kim, J.H., Bansal, J.C. (eds) Third Congress on Intelligent Systems. CIS 2022. Lecture Notes in Networks and Systems, vol 608. Springer, Singapore. https://doi.org/10.1007/978-981-19-9225-4_17

- [Introduction](#introduction)
- [Features](#features)
- [Installation](#installation)
- [Contribution](#contribution)
- [Future Improvements](#future-improvements)

## Introduction
The main objective of the Python framework is to automate systematic reviews to save reviewers time without creating 
constraints that might affect the review quality. The other objective is to create an open-source and highly 
customisable framework with options to use or improve any parts of the framework. python framework supports each step in
the systematic review workflow and suggests using checklists provided by Preferred Reporting Items for Systematic Reviews
and Meta-Analyses (PRISMA). 

### Authors
<img align="left" width="231.95" height="75" src="https://raw.githubusercontent.com/chandraveshchaudhari/personal-information/initial_setup/images/christ.png">

The packages [systematic-reviewpy](https://github.com/chandraveshchaudhari/systematic-reviewpy) and 
[browser-automationpy](https://github.com/chandraveshchaudhari/browser-automationpy) are part of Research paper 
`An open-source Python framework for systematic review based on PRISMA` created by [Chandravesh chaudhari][chandravesh linkedin], Doctoral candidate at [CHRIST (Deemed to be University), Bangalore, India][christ university website] under supervision of [Dr. Geetanjali purswani][geetanjali linkedin].

<br/>

[chandravesh linkedin]: https://www.linkedin.com/in/chandravesh-chaudhari "chandravesh linkedin profile"
[geetanjali linkedin]: https://www.linkedin.com/in/dr-geetanjali-purswani-546336b8 "geetanjali linkedin profile"
[christ university website]: https://christuniversity.in/ "website"

## Features
- supported file types: ris, json, and [pandas IO](https://pandas.pydata.org/pandas-docs/stable/user_guide/io.html)   
- supports the complete workflow for systematic reviews.
- supports to combine multiple databases citations.
- supports searching words with boolean conditions and filter based on counts.
- browser automation using [browser-automationpy](https://github.com/chandraveshchaudhari/browser-automationpy)
- validation of downloaded articles.
- contains natural language processing techniques such as stemming and lemmatisation for text mining. 
- sorting selected research papers based on database.
- generating literature review excel or csv file.
- automatically generates analysis tables and graphs.
- automatically generates workflow diagram.
- generate the ASReview supported file for Active-learning Screening

#### Significance
- Saves time
- Automate monotonous tasks
- Never makes mistakes
- Provides replicable results

## Installation 
This project is available at [PyPI](https://pypi.org/project/systematic-reviewpy/). For help in installation check 
[instructions](https://packaging.python.org/tutorials/installing-packages/#installing-from-pypi)
```bash
python3 -m pip install systematic-reviewpy  
```

### Dependencies
##### Required
- [rispy](https://pypi.org/project/rispy/) - A Python 3.6+ reader/writer of RIS reference files.
- [pandas](https://pypi.org/project/pandas/) - A Python package that provides fast, flexible, and expressive data 
structures designed to make working with "relational" or "labeled" data both easy and intuitive.
##### Optional
- [browser-automationpy](https://github.com/chandraveshchaudhari/browser-automationpy/)
- [pdftotext](https://pypi.org/project/pdftotext/) - Simple PDF text extraction
- [PyMuPDF](https://pypi.org/project/PyMuPDF/) - PyMuPDF (current version 1.19.2) - A Python binding with support for 
MuPDF, a lightweight PDF, XPS, and E-book viewer, renderer, and toolkit.

## Important links
- [Documentation](https://chandraveshchaudhari.github.io/systematic-reviewpy/)
- [Quick tour](https://chandraveshchaudhari.github.io/systematic-reviewpy/systematic-reviewpy%20tutorial.html)
- [Project maintainer (feel free to contact)](mailto:chandraveshchaudhari@gmail.com?subject=[GitHub]%20Source%20sytematic-reviewpy) 
- [Future Improvements](https://github.com/chandraveshchaudhari/systematic-reviewpy/projects)
- [License](https://github.com/chandraveshchaudhari/systematic-reviewpy/blob/master/LICENSE.txt)

## Contribution
all kinds of contributions are appreciated.
- [Improving readability of documentation](https://chandraveshchaudhari.github.io/systematic-reviewpy/)
- [Feature Request](https://github.com/chandraveshchaudhari/systematic-reviewpy/issues/new/choose)
- [Reporting bugs](https://github.com/chandraveshchaudhari/systematic-reviewpy/issues/new/choose)
- [Contribute code](https://github.com/chandraveshchaudhari/systematic-reviewpy/compare)
- [Asking questions in discussions](https://github.com/chandraveshchaudhari/systematic-reviewpy/discussions)

## Future Improvements
- [ ] Web based GUI



            

Raw data

            {
    "_id": null,
    "home_page": "https://github.com/chandraveshchaudhari/browser-automationpy",
    "name": "brain-multiple-modalities-automl",
    "maintainer": null,
    "docs_url": null,
    "requires_python": "<4,>=3.6",
    "maintainer_email": null,
    "keywords": "browser, automation, selenium, testing, data mining",
    "author": "A. Random Developer",
    "author_email": "author@example.com",
    "download_url": "https://files.pythonhosted.org/packages/0a/53/3a5bc742a1d58af7b82dfedfc38dfd50c83369ebd165b1134baba18283bc/brain_multiple_modalities_automl-0.0.1.tar.gz",
    "platform": null,
    "description": "# Brain-AutoML\n<div align=\"center\">\n  <img src=\"https://raw.githubusercontent.com/chandraveshchaudhari/personal-information/initial_setup/logos/my%20github%20logo%20template-systematic-reviewpy%20small.png\" width=\"640\" height=\"320\">\n</div>\n\n# An open-source Python framework for systematic review based on PRISMA : systematic-reviewpy\n> Chaudhari, C., Purswani, G. (2023). Stock Market Prediction Techniques Using Artificial Intelligence: A Systematic Review. In: Kumar, S., Sharma, H., Balachandran, K., Kim, J.H., Bansal, J.C. (eds) Third Congress on Intelligent Systems. CIS 2022. Lecture Notes in Networks and Systems, vol 608. Springer, Singapore. https://doi.org/10.1007/978-981-19-9225-4_17\n\n- [Introduction](#introduction)\n- [Features](#features)\n- [Installation](#installation)\n- [Contribution](#contribution)\n- [Future Improvements](#future-improvements)\n\n## Introduction\nThe main objective of the Python framework is to automate systematic reviews to save reviewers time without creating \nconstraints that might affect the review quality. The other objective is to create an open-source and highly \ncustomisable framework with options to use or improve any parts of the framework. python framework supports each step in\nthe systematic review workflow and suggests using checklists provided by Preferred Reporting Items for Systematic Reviews\nand Meta-Analyses (PRISMA). \n\n### Authors\n<img align=\"left\" width=\"231.95\" height=\"75\" src=\"https://raw.githubusercontent.com/chandraveshchaudhari/personal-information/initial_setup/images/christ.png\">\n\nThe packages [systematic-reviewpy](https://github.com/chandraveshchaudhari/systematic-reviewpy) and \n[browser-automationpy](https://github.com/chandraveshchaudhari/browser-automationpy) are part of Research paper \n`An open-source Python framework for systematic review based on PRISMA` created by [Chandravesh chaudhari][chandravesh linkedin], Doctoral candidate at [CHRIST (Deemed to be University), Bangalore, India][christ university website] under supervision of [Dr. Geetanjali purswani][geetanjali linkedin].\n\n<br/>\n\n[chandravesh linkedin]: https://www.linkedin.com/in/chandravesh-chaudhari \"chandravesh linkedin profile\"\n[geetanjali linkedin]: https://www.linkedin.com/in/dr-geetanjali-purswani-546336b8 \"geetanjali linkedin profile\"\n[christ university website]: https://christuniversity.in/ \"website\"\n\n## Features\n- supported file types: ris, json, and [pandas IO](https://pandas.pydata.org/pandas-docs/stable/user_guide/io.html)   \n- supports the complete workflow for systematic reviews.\n- supports to combine multiple databases citations.\n- supports searching words with boolean conditions and filter based on counts.\n- browser automation using [browser-automationpy](https://github.com/chandraveshchaudhari/browser-automationpy)\n- validation of downloaded articles.\n- contains natural language processing techniques such as stemming and lemmatisation for text mining. \n- sorting selected research papers based on database.\n- generating literature review excel or csv file.\n- automatically generates analysis tables and graphs.\n- automatically generates workflow diagram.\n- generate the ASReview supported file for Active-learning Screening\n\n#### Significance\n- Saves time\n- Automate monotonous tasks\n- Never makes mistakes\n- Provides replicable results\n\n## Installation \nThis project is available at [PyPI](https://pypi.org/project/systematic-reviewpy/). For help in installation check \n[instructions](https://packaging.python.org/tutorials/installing-packages/#installing-from-pypi)\n```bash\npython3 -m pip install systematic-reviewpy  \n```\n\n### Dependencies\n##### Required\n- [rispy](https://pypi.org/project/rispy/) - A Python 3.6+ reader/writer of RIS reference files.\n- [pandas](https://pypi.org/project/pandas/) - A Python package that provides fast, flexible, and expressive data \nstructures designed to make working with \"relational\" or \"labeled\" data both easy and intuitive.\n##### Optional\n- [browser-automationpy](https://github.com/chandraveshchaudhari/browser-automationpy/)\n- [pdftotext](https://pypi.org/project/pdftotext/) - Simple PDF text extraction\n- [PyMuPDF](https://pypi.org/project/PyMuPDF/) - PyMuPDF (current version 1.19.2) - A Python binding with support for \nMuPDF, a lightweight PDF, XPS, and E-book viewer, renderer, and toolkit.\n\n## Important links\n- [Documentation](https://chandraveshchaudhari.github.io/systematic-reviewpy/)\n- [Quick tour](https://chandraveshchaudhari.github.io/systematic-reviewpy/systematic-reviewpy%20tutorial.html)\n- [Project maintainer (feel free to contact)](mailto:chandraveshchaudhari@gmail.com?subject=[GitHub]%20Source%20sytematic-reviewpy) \n- [Future Improvements](https://github.com/chandraveshchaudhari/systematic-reviewpy/projects)\n- [License](https://github.com/chandraveshchaudhari/systematic-reviewpy/blob/master/LICENSE.txt)\n\n## Contribution\nall kinds of contributions are appreciated.\n- [Improving readability of documentation](https://chandraveshchaudhari.github.io/systematic-reviewpy/)\n- [Feature Request](https://github.com/chandraveshchaudhari/systematic-reviewpy/issues/new/choose)\n- [Reporting bugs](https://github.com/chandraveshchaudhari/systematic-reviewpy/issues/new/choose)\n- [Contribute code](https://github.com/chandraveshchaudhari/systematic-reviewpy/compare)\n- [Asking questions in discussions](https://github.com/chandraveshchaudhari/systematic-reviewpy/discussions)\n\n## Future Improvements\n- [ ] Web based GUI\n\n\n",
    "bugtrack_url": null,
    "license": null,
    "summary": "A Python project",
    "version": "0.0.1",
    "project_urls": {
        "Bug Reports": "https://github.com/chandraveshchaudhari/browser-automationpy/issues",
        "Bug Tracker": "https://github.com/chandraveshchaudhari/browser-automationpy/issues",
        "Homepage": "https://github.com/chandraveshchaudhari/browser-automationpy",
        "Say Thanks!": "https://saythanks.io/to/chandraveshchaudhari",
        "Source": "https://github.com/chandraveshchaudhari/browser-automationpy/"
    },
    "split_keywords": [
        "browser",
        " automation",
        " selenium",
        " testing",
        " data mining"
    ],
    "urls": [
        {
            "comment_text": "",
            "digests": {
                "blake2b_256": "f26048582e18ca9fe2b711df34c5dc1c29305bf53713386f611ecc6ebfe58438",
                "md5": "a93ca874a2b9c84a49d8f91c5112ca22",
                "sha256": "4be4b1fec0bfba80de733729bd539516b1c691ef3c999a8406343177879a03b4"
            },
            "downloads": -1,
            "filename": "brain_multiple_modalities_automl-0.0.1-py3-none-any.whl",
            "has_sig": false,
            "md5_digest": "a93ca874a2b9c84a49d8f91c5112ca22",
            "packagetype": "bdist_wheel",
            "python_version": "py3",
            "requires_python": "<4,>=3.6",
            "size": 52783,
            "upload_time": "2024-05-29T13:24:55",
            "upload_time_iso_8601": "2024-05-29T13:24:55.458176Z",
            "url": "https://files.pythonhosted.org/packages/f2/60/48582e18ca9fe2b711df34c5dc1c29305bf53713386f611ecc6ebfe58438/brain_multiple_modalities_automl-0.0.1-py3-none-any.whl",
            "yanked": false,
            "yanked_reason": null
        },
        {
            "comment_text": "",
            "digests": {
                "blake2b_256": "0a533a5bc742a1d58af7b82dfedfc38dfd50c83369ebd165b1134baba18283bc",
                "md5": "ea100fb8aed794dfc911c006604f291f",
                "sha256": "39e3a9ded0a59a078cc29b4cfbb1f7f026ef2b6e007bf2af23e738eb0c1be21a"
            },
            "downloads": -1,
            "filename": "brain_multiple_modalities_automl-0.0.1.tar.gz",
            "has_sig": false,
            "md5_digest": "ea100fb8aed794dfc911c006604f291f",
            "packagetype": "sdist",
            "python_version": "source",
            "requires_python": "<4,>=3.6",
            "size": 105758,
            "upload_time": "2024-05-29T13:24:58",
            "upload_time_iso_8601": "2024-05-29T13:24:58.508883Z",
            "url": "https://files.pythonhosted.org/packages/0a/53/3a5bc742a1d58af7b82dfedfc38dfd50c83369ebd165b1134baba18283bc/brain_multiple_modalities_automl-0.0.1.tar.gz",
            "yanked": false,
            "yanked_reason": null
        }
    ],
    "upload_time": "2024-05-29 13:24:58",
    "github": true,
    "gitlab": false,
    "bitbucket": false,
    "codeberg": false,
    "github_user": "chandraveshchaudhari",
    "github_project": "browser-automationpy",
    "travis_ci": false,
    "coveralls": false,
    "github_actions": false,
    "lcname": "brain-multiple-modalities-automl"
}
        
Elapsed time: 0.31345s